			<description><![CDATA[<p>This evening I enjoyed my ride home after the free hour at Barton Springs thanks to the brand new bike lane on the east-bound side of the street. The lane extends between the Barton Springs entrance all the way to the bridge just before Robert E Lee.</p><p>I also noticed that while Northbound Guadalupe (the drag section) was resurfaced, the bike lane seems to have narrowed when it was striped.</p><p><a href="http://www.greenupload.com/uploaded/images/2008/08/29/GreenUpload.Com_1219988743_Zilker_bike_lane.jpg" rel="ugc">http://www.greenupload.com/uploaded/ima … e_lane.jpg</a></p><p><span class="postimg"><img src="http://www.greenupload.com/uploaded/images/2008/08/29/GreenUpload.Com_1219988743_Zilker_bike_lane.jpg" alt="GreenUpload.Com_1219988743_Zilker_bike_lane.jpg" /></span></p><p>Seth</p>]]></description>
